Understanding Gore-Tex Technology
Gore-Tex is a specialized membrane that provides waterproofing while allowing moisture to escape. This unique combination ensures your feet stay dry from external water while minimizing sweat accumulation inside the shoe. This is crucial for runners who face rain or wet conditions regularly. How Gore-Tex Works
The Gore-Tex membrane is made of expanded polytetrafluoroethylene (ePTFE), which consists of over 1.4 billion pores per square centimeter. Each pore is 20,000 times smaller than a water droplet, preventing water from entering while allowing sweat vapor to escape. This feature is essential for maintaining comfort during long runs.
Benefits of Wearing Gore-Tex Running Shoes
1. Waterproofing
Gore-Tex running shoes are engineered to keep your feet dry in wet conditions. Whether you’re running through puddles or on snowy trails, these shoes offer reliable protection.
2. Breathability
While they are waterproof, these shoes also allow moisture to escape. This breathability prevents overheating and keeps your feet comfortable during intense runs.
3. Durability
Gore-Tex materials are designed to withstand harsh conditions. This durability can prolong the life of your running shoes, making them a worthwhile investment.
4. Versatility
Many Gore-Tex running shoes are designed for various terrains, including roads and trails. This means you can use them for different types of runs without needing multiple pairs.
Choosing the Right Gore-Tex Running Shoes
Consider Your Running Environment
Your choice of Gore-Tex running shoes should depend on where you plan to run. If you’re hitting the trails, look for shoes with rugged outsoles and additional ankle support. For road running, opt for lightweight models that prioritize cushioning.
Fit and Comfort
Always try on shoes before buying. Ensure they fit snugly without being too tight. Pay attention to areas like the heel and toe box to avoid discomfort during runs.
Weight
Lighter shoes are generally better for speed, while heavier models may provide more protection and durability. Consider your running style and preferences when selecting weight.

Care and Maintenance of Gore-Tex Running Shoes
To extend the life of your Gore-Tex running shoes, proper care is essential. Follow these tips:
- Cleaning: Clean your shoes regularly with a damp cloth to remove dirt and debris.
- Drying: Allow them to air dry naturally. Avoid direct heat sources, which can damage the material.
- Waterproofing: Consider reapplying a waterproofing spray periodically to maintain their water resistance.

FAQ
What are Gore-Tex running shoes?
Gore-Tex running shoes are designed with a waterproof and breathable membrane that keeps your feet dry while allowing moisture to escape. This technology makes them ideal for running in wet conditions.
Are Gore-Tex running shoes worth the investment?
Yes, if you frequently run in wet or unpredictable weather, Gore-Tex shoes can provide comfort and protection that standard running shoes may not offer.
How do I clean my Gore-Tex running shoes?
Clean them with a damp cloth to remove dirt. Avoid using harsh detergents. Allow them to air dry naturally, and do not use a dryer or heat source.
Can I use Gore-Tex running shoes for trail running?
Absolutely! Many Gore-Tex models are specifically designed for trail running, offering additional grip and stability for uneven terrains.
Do Gore-Tex shoes run true to size?
Most brands offer a true-to-size fit, but it’s always best to try them on or check size guides. Different brands may have slight variations in sizing.
How often should I replace my Gore-Tex running shoes?
Replace them every 300-500 miles, depending on your running style and terrain. Signs of wear include decreased cushioning and loss of waterproofing.
Can I wear Gore-Tex shoes in hot weather?
While they can be worn in warm conditions, they may trap more heat than non-waterproof shoes. Ensure you choose well-ventilated models for better comfort.
Are there any downsides to Gore-Tex running shoes?
They can be heavier than non-waterproof shoes and may retain more heat, which could be uncomfortable in hot weather.
